#3872 Winchester 1885 Hi-Wall, No.3, .38/55, 30-inch barrel, 33XXX serial range (1889) and having a VG bore (about a 6-7 on a scale of 10) with some light scale in the grooves but strong rifling and well defined lands. Typical tight solid action. Smooth crisp metal with about 90-95% coverage of a soft 70% density barrel blue that is plumming slightly; the frame case coloring has faded and silvered out to a thin swirled silver-grey. Decent wood with no really serious deficits or detractions other than a well done repair to a chip at the lower toe area, and inexplicably does have a well-done filled in ˝-inch area behind the lower tang, as if the tang were longer at one time (…perhaps a wide spaced double set trigger had been installed at some point?) This caliber is always highly sought after in the Model 1885, as it is still a widely available cartridge and was quite accurate for a larger straight case black-powder caliber. Fitted with the factory optional Beeches style flip-up ringed front sight and standard open semi-buckhorn rear barrel sight, standard trigger. About Fine, as described. $2895
